So day 1 after my Hair restoration procedure  with Eugenix.

I flew in from Thailand and didn’t have a pro intend visa as my EA organised my Visa for India and I forgot to print it, luckily I emailed the airline staff and they printed it for me.

I landed in India and got transported to the Farm house, My wife  was coming in later form Australia to meet me.

After she arrived she was having a bite to eat and noticed I had a rash, I had a rash all over my body I dint know if it was the food or bed bugs who knows I have never ever had a rash this big practically  all over my body, we went to the TJ the next day priory to my procedure Dr Sethi came and saw me and gave me some medications and we moved to the Westin for the night. 

The day of my procedure my rash was getting better, Dr Erika did my hairline design, my wife wanted to also do my temporal points but Dr Erika wasn’t confident that I should do them. Originally I was suppose to do do 3,000 grafts just for the front part of my hair but Dr Erika said I had great dinner so we could do the crown also.

So I ended up with just under 4,000 grafts.

Dr Sethi popped in to say hello and showed us a tour of the place and we got chatting and he jumped in and redid my hairline design and added the temporal points so in the end Dr Sethi and my wife decided I was doin those as well.

Dr Sethi is quite the character and just a positive fun guy to hang around with.

The procedure was a lot more comfortable and less painful than I thought it would be, a very professional team all doing their thing I had 3 working on my head directly and probably 2-3 other people as well, this made everything go fast and smooth.

This is the day after surgery and I feel totally fine, I didn’t sleep well as when i sleep on my back I snore and keep waking up, tonight I will try on my side but still avoiding touching the grafts.

 

14 years back i had my front hairline done in Sydney by an Australian dr and the difference was chalk and cheese, I was in so much pain for days afterwards and the Anastasia made my head bloated and my eyes where nearly closed shut and where all yellow, he didn’t tell me anything he just finesse the job and said see you latter i had no idea about the sailing how to sleep when to wash or anything really, and now I am in my hotel room nice a relaxed no pain and I look relatively normal.

 

here are the pics day 1, i will keep everyone update as my journey continues, as we should all know on this forum its not until 9 months where the real results start, so far so good.

Day 6

the last few days my donor on the back of my head has been really sore , maybe because I have been sleeping on my back and that part has been touching the pillow, it’s so painful I can’t sleep, otherwise everything is going well have been spraying saline every 2 hours. When I first got my hair transplant I thought it was lob sided but I think that’s because I was lob sided before the procedure.
